Cylindrical Grinding - Fine MetalWorking
Your objective of doing cylindrical grinding is-. To get a good surface finish. Geometrical accuracy like concentricity between two or more diameters on a shaft or between the bore and outside diameter of a cylindrical work-piece. Most importantly, to machine the hardened work-piece for which grinding is the only machining process.

Spindle shaft grinding - Cp Grinding
The spindle shaft must absorb all machining forces that occur during cutting with the lowest possible strain response, generate / transmit the cutting power provided by an internal or external drive for machining, and exhibit high accuracy positioning and travel. Different types of spindle shafts are used in machine tools to meet different needs.

When I put my car into drive it makes a loud grinding noi...
The grinding noise is the gear train being destroyed or the CV shaft spinning. Check under the vehicle to see what has failed. If you see the CV shaft spinning, then the CV shaft was broken and needs replaced. If the CV shafts do not move and are solid, then the transmission needs rebuilt or replaced, if the shell is not broken.

Shaft Machining_Technology, Material, Tolerance ...
Drive shaft machining process: Material preparation → Turning both ends, drilling center hole →Rough turning each outer circle→ quenching →Repair grinding center hole →Semi-precision turning of the outer circle, slot, chamfering →Thread→ Keying Groove Processing Line →Milling keyway→ Repair grinding center hole→ Grinding ...

Symptoms of a Bad or Failing Driveshaft | YourMechanic …
A driveshaft is a cylindrical shaft that transmits torque from the engine to the wheels. They are most commonly found on rear-wheel drive vehicles and connect the rear of the transmission to the driveshaft. As the output shaft of the transmission rotates it spins the driveshaft, which then turns the differential ring gear to rotate the wheels.

Driveline/Propshaft 101 - 4Crawler.com
To do this, you "split" the drive shaft angle between the two u-joints. So if you have a 10° angle from the transmission/transfer case output to the drive shaft, you set the upper u-joint angle to 5° and the lower u-joint angle to 5°. This setup has the advantage of a lesser operating angle on the u-joints (5° vs. 10° in this case).
